Grenades, pistols found stowed in Brooklyn basement

A contractor cleaning out a Brooklyn basement made a startling discovery Tuesday — a couple of grenades and two pistols hidden in the debris, cops said.

The worker found the inert grenades and guns inside the Bleecker Street apartment building near Myrtle Avenue while cleaning out the abandoned structure just after noon, according to police. The building is being cleaned for renovations.

The worker brought the grenades and pistols to the 83rd Precinct station house, where cops locked them up in the basement for the bomb squad to investigate, police said.

It wasn’t immediately clear who the weapons belonged to, but police said the investigation in ongoing.
